In this episode of the Executive Function Brain Trainer podcast, host Erica Warren welcomes back Kim Sorise for an insightful discussion on executive functioning resets at the start of new semesters. They emphasize the importance of reflecting on the prior semester to identify what worked and what didn't, and how this reflection fosters resilience and cognitive flexibility in students. The conversation covers practical strategies like organizing lockers, desks, and using digital tools such as Google Calendar and Keep for better management. They also delve into study techniques, leveraging AI tools, maintaining productive routines, and the significance of adding playtime and downtime in busy schedules. In this episode of the Executive Function Brain Trainer Podcast, hosts Dr. Erica Warren welcomes back guest Kim Sorise to discuss effective strategies for building executive functioning skills during breaks. The conversation covers various tactics, such as actively engaging children in tasks like co-piloting during road trips, cooking, reading maps, and even gardening to foster cognitive flexibility, planning, sequencing, and emotional regulation. In today's episode, I sit down with Mark Papadas, author, coach, and founder of I AM 4 Kids, to talk about building self-identity early in life. After years of coaching adults, Mark realized real change starts with kids, teaching them to control their own "I Am" statements before negative self-talk takes root. We break down how children pick up damaging beliefs without anyone intentionally teaching them, and why phrases like "I'm fat" or "I'm stupid" become internalized far too young. Mark shares how persistence, curiosity, and ingenuity come naturally to kids, and how keeping those traits alive can transform their confidence for life. His work combines entertainment, education, and family coaching to rewire how kids view themselves.
